Transaction 8bcd5e5276c37537ae80e792af7e18facfebc33a7e59371cdb824df789f751e3

2 Input
2 Outputs
  • 8bcd5e5276c37537ae80e792af7e18facfebc33a7e59371cdb824df789f751e3:0
  • value  14708
    address  3FS7BYPMUMDTEADEFAUrjCmV2QAbee8YKv
  • 8bcd5e5276c37537ae80e792af7e18facfebc33a7e59371cdb824df789f751e3:1
  • value  27000000
    address  39GQn9cc2XZbCQD4mgbtif4V57eM6SFvzK